Hi,

Since fewer and fewer applications are available as 32-bit only, I'm
looking into disabling 32-bit compatibilty altogether. I don't have
the Linuxulator enabled, so that won't be a problem. I just replaced
rar with unrar, and that got rid of the last piece of 32-bit software
that I'm aware of. However, I want to be absolutely certain that there
is nothing left before I remove the compatibility layer and the
libraries. Is there a quick way to scan for any 32-bit binaries?
